#4b3ba7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b3ba7 is composed of 29.4% red, 23.1% green and 65.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 64.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 248.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.8% and a lightness of 44.3%. #4b3ba7 color hex could be obtained by blending #9676ff with #00004f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#4b3ba7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4b3ba7 has RGB values of R:75, G:59, B:167 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 4930471.

Hex triplet 4b3ba7 #4b3ba7
RGB Decimal 75, 59, 167 rgb(75,59,167)
RGB Percent 29.4, 23.1, 65.5 rgb(29.4%,23.1%,65.5%)
CMYK 55, 65, 0, 35
HSL 248.9°, 47.8, 44.3 hsl(248.9,47.8%,44.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 248.9°, 64.7, 65.5
Web Safe 333399 #333399
CIE-LAB 32.73, 36.82, -56.03
XYZ 11.439, 7.413, 37.385
xyY 0.203, 0.132, 7.413
CIE-LCH 32.73, 67.046, 303.311
CIE-LUV 32.73, -1.259, -78.363
Hunter-Lab 27.228, 27.346, -62.349
Binary 01001011, 00111011, 10100111

Shades and Tints of #4b3ba7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030308 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b3ba7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706f73 is the less saturated color, while #2607db is the most saturated one.
